How many questions are on the Spania driving test?
The Spania driving theory test has 30 questions. You need 27/30 (90%) to pass. The test duration is 30 minutes.
What score do you need to pass the Spania driving test?
To pass the Spania driving theory test, you need 27/30 (90%). This means you can make a maximum of 3 mistakes.
How long is the Spania driving theory test?
The Spania driving theory test lasts 30 minutes. During this time, you must answer 30 questions. This gives you approximately 60 seconds per question.

How much does the Spania driving test cost?
The Spania driving theory test costs approximately 94.05€. This fee covers the official examination. Additional costs may include: driving school fees, practical test fees, and license issuance fees. Prices may vary and are subject to change.
What is the minimum age to get a driving license in Spania?
The minimum age to obtain a driving license in Spania is 18 years old. You can typically start learning to drive before this age with a provisional license or learner's permit, depending on local regulations.
What documents do I need for the Spania driving test?
To take the driving test in Spania, you need: DNI/NIE, Medical certificate, Photo, Fee payment, Proof of address (empadronamiento). Make sure all documents are valid and up to date before your test appointment.
How long is a Spania driving license valid?
A Spania driving license is valid for 10 years (5 years if 65+). After this period, you'll need to renew your license, which may require a medical examination depending on your age.
What is the drink driving limit in Spania?
The legal blood alcohol limit for driving in Spania is 0.5g/L (0.3g/L for new drivers). Penalties for drink driving are severe and can include fines, license suspension, and imprisonment. New and young drivers often have stricter limits.
What are the speed limits in Spania?
Speed limits in Spania: Urban/City areas: 50 km/h, Rural roads: 90 km/h, Highways/Motorways: 120 km/h. Always watch for posted signs as limits may vary.
What side of the road do you drive on in Spania?
In Spania, you drive on the RIGHT side of the road. The steering wheel is on the left side of the vehicle. This is important to remember if you're visiting from a country that drives on the opposite side.
What is the format of the Spania driving theory test?
The Spania driving theory test consists of 30 multiple-choice questions. You have 30 minutes to complete the test. The test is administered by DGT (Dirección General de Tráfico).
What are the unique driving rules in Spania?
Important driving rules specific to Spania include: Priority to vehicles from the right at unmarked intersections. V-16 emergency beacon required for Spanish-registered vehicles (from 2026); warning triangles still required for foreign-registered vehicles. Reflective vest mandatory. Dipped headlights in tunnels. Understanding these rules is essential for passing your driving test and driving safely.

What is the emergency number for road accidents in Spania?
The emergency number in Spania is 112. In case of a road accident, call this number immediately. Keep your location details ready and follow the operator's instructions.
